Subject: Quiet Room — Floor 12

Assistants,

The quiet room on the top floor (12) is now reserved for focus work only. No calls, no meetings, no food. Book slots through the usual calendar. Lights are motion-sensored; door locks automatically after 18:00.

Entry requires the current door-pass code, listed below.

turnstile pass: bdg-TXR-4

Ticket: Staging env misconfigured for Siftgate bloom filter

The bloom layer in front of the Pellet KV store is rejecting all lookups in staging because the env file was copied from the dev template without credentials. False-positive tuning values are fine; only the auth line is missing. To unblock the weekly demo, the Pellet admission secret must be set on the following line.

env line for yaguf-fajop: LEDGER_TOKEN13=fb08984397349

Action item: The Relayn deploy-status bot silently dropped updates when the pipeline API paginated results, so responders believed a rollback had completed when it had not. We will add pagination handling, a staleness banner, and an integration test. Until merged, verify deploy state directly in the pipeline console, documented at the page below.

runbook for kahop-kajop: https://rundeck.ordinio.test/display/secrets/pipeline/issue/pages/repo/browse/e5732776e07d1285107e5aeb

# NightLoom backfill scheduler — environment configuration
# Maintained for the release manager; review before each cut.
# NightLoom orchestrates nightly data backfills across the Ferrow warehouse
# tiers. All timing values below (BACKFILL_WINDOW_START, BACKFILL_MAX_SHARDS)
# are safe to change between releases without a redeploy; the scheduler
# re-reads them at midnight. The warehouse write credential is the one
# sensitive value in this file and must never be copied into release notes.
# The line immediately below sets that credential:

sealed setting: LEDGER_TOKEN5=bcca1

# Break-Glass: Catalog Cache Invalidation

Scope: the Pinrow product catalog at Veldstone Retail. If stale prices persist after a purge and the Hollowmere invalidation queue is wedged, use break-glass to flush the edge tier directly. Contractors: get verbal sign-off from the catalog lead first. Steps: open the Hollowmere admin shell, select emergency-flush, confirm the tenant, and run it once — repeated flushes thrash the origin. Access is logged and expires after 20 minutes. Unseal the admin shell with the passphrase below.

recovery phrase for kahop-tajog: istix-casvan